Kasbah Flame is a commanding work of textile art — a one-of-a-kind, heirloom-quality Boujaad rug handwoven in the Middle Atlas Mountains of Morocco from 100% natural, high-lanolin wool. Part of the celebrated Boujaad weaving tradition, it showcases bold motifs, expressive colours, and rich cultural symbolism.
The composition blends Amazigh symbolism with modernist abstraction: earthy terracotta, golden saffron, deep black, and cobalt blue emerge from a soft cream base, recalling the silhouette of a ceremonial vessel under the desert sun. Each shade is created from natural, hand-mixed dyes for depth, vibrancy, and an organic, lived-in beauty.
Finished start-to-finish by a single master artisan, Kasbah Flame embodies the Boujaad style’s plush texture, artistic freedom, and narrative power — a tactile, functional work of art that infuses any space with heritage and warmth.
Rug Details
- Style: Authentic Boujaad rug
- One-of-a-Kind: Woven start-to-finish by a single Berber artisan
- Dimensions: Approx. 1.7 × 2.5m (≈ 5.6 × 8.2 ft)
- Material: 100% natural, high-lanolin wool
- Technique: Traditional hand-knotting; natural, hand-mixed dyes
- Origin: Boujaad, Middle Atlas, Morocco
- Fringe details: Finished with traditional hand-twisted tassels
- Colour Palette: Terracotta, saffron, black, cobalt blue, cream
Handmade character: slight (±3%) variations in size, shade, and motif are hallmarks of true craft.
